dc.description.abstractThe work examines the general blood circulation and studies typical peripheral disorders. It is shown that pathological arterial hyperemia can be divided by the mechanism of development into neurogenic and developing under the direct action of metabolites on the walls of blood vessels. Characteristic signs of ischemia and classification of thrombi are given.
